Jerboas are the tiny acrobats of the desert. With their long hind legs and tufted tails, they hop and leap like miniature kangaroos, covering great distances in a single bound. Perfectly adapted to their arid homes, jerboas survive without drinking water, getting all the moisture they need from their food. These nocturnal wonders are shy, quick, and incredibly resourceful, using their burrows to stay cool during the day and hidden from predators. Despite their small size, jerboas are mighty survivors, thriving in some of the harshest environments on Earth.
While our A/W collection introduces a variety of wool fabrics, we remain devoted to our signature textile: linen. Often associated with summer, linen is widely misunderstood as a warm-weather-only fabric. In reality, its natural properties extend far beyond the sun-drenched months — linen fibres are even used in eco-friendly home insulation for their breathability and thermoregulation.
In our collection, we pair a top layer of premium wool with a soft linen lining to create garments that offer exceptional warmth and comfort. The synergy between these two natural materials helps regulate body temperature, preventing overheating by effectively absorbing and releasing moisture.
